Note Program originally broadcast on PBS on Nov. 2, 2005; DVD contains several additional interviews not included in the television broadcast, and lacks one scene that was included in the broadcast.
Summary This documentary profiles people who are living with the grave consequences of a changing climate, as well as the individuals, communities and scientists inventing new approaches to safeguard our children's future. Filmed across the U.S., Asia and South America, this program brings the reality of climate change to life and offers viewers a variety of ways to make a difference in their own communities.
